View | Details | Raw Unified | Return to bug 9869
Collapse All | Expand All

(-)amarok-1.4.1/amarok/configure.in.in~ (-1 / +1 lines)
Lines 617-623 if test "$with_libvisual" = "yes"; then Link Here
617
617
618
    if test x$PKGCONFIGFOUND = xyes -a x$SDL_CONFIG = xyes; then
618
    if test x$PKGCONFIGFOUND = xyes -a x$SDL_CONFIG = xyes; then
619
619
620
        PKG_CHECK_MODULES(LIBVISUAL, libvisual-0.4 >= 0.4.0, [build_libvisual="yes"], [build_libvisual="no"])
620
        PKG_CHECK_MODULES(LIBVISUAL, libvisual >= 0.2.0, [build_libvisual="yes"], [build_libvisual="no"])
621
621
622
        AC_SUBST(LIBVISUAL_LIBS)
622
        AC_SUBST(LIBVISUAL_LIBS)
623
        AC_SUBST(LIBVISUAL_CFLAGS)
623
        AC_SUBST(LIBVISUAL_CFLAGS)
(-)amarok-1.4.1/amarok/src/vis/libvisual/libvisual.cpp~ (-5 / +5 lines)
Lines 40-46 main( int argc, char** argv ) Link Here
40
        }
40
        }
41
        #endif
41
        #endif
42
42
43
        const char *plugin = 0;
43
        const char *plugin = NULL;
44
44
45
        while( (plugin = visual_actor_get_next_by_name( plugin )) )
45
        while( (plugin = visual_actor_get_next_by_name( plugin )) )
46
            std::cout << plugin << '\n';
46
            std::cout << plugin << '\n';
Lines 87-93 main( int argc, char** argv ) Link Here
87
        FD_ZERO( &fds );
87
        FD_ZERO( &fds );
88
        FD_SET( sockfd, &fds );
88
        FD_SET( sockfd, &fds );
89
89
90
        ::select( sockfd+1, &fds, 0, 0, &tv );
90
        ::select( sockfd+1, &fds, NULL, NULL, &tv );
91
91
92
        if( FD_ISSET( sockfd, &fds) ) {
92
        if( FD_ISSET( sockfd, &fds) ) {
93
            //amaroK sent us some data
93
            //amaroK sent us some data
Lines 253-259 namespace SDL Link Here
253
                      visual_bin_switch_actor_by_name( Vis::bin, (char*)Vis::plugin );
253
                      visual_bin_switch_actor_by_name( Vis::bin, (char*)Vis::plugin );
254
                    SDL::unlock();
254
                    SDL::unlock();
255
255
256
                    SDL_WM_SetCaption( Vis::plugin, 0 );
256
                    SDL_WM_SetCaption( Vis::plugin, NULL );
257
257
258
                    break;
258
                    break;
259
259
Lines 331-337 namespace LibVisual Link Here
331
        bin    = visual_bin_new ();
331
        bin    = visual_bin_new ();
332
        depth  = visual_video_depth_enum_from_value( 24 );
332
        depth  = visual_video_depth_enum_from_value( 24 );
333
333
334
        if( !plugin ) plugin = visual_actor_get_next_by_name( 0 );
334
        if( !plugin ) plugin = visual_actor_get_next_by_name( NULL );
335
        if( !plugin ) exit( "Actor plugin not found!" );
335
        if( !plugin ) exit( "Actor plugin not found!" );
336
336
337
        visual_bin_set_supported_depth( bin, VISUAL_VIDEO_DEPTH_ALL );
337
        visual_bin_set_supported_depth( bin, VISUAL_VIDEO_DEPTH_ALL );
Lines 343-349 namespace LibVisual Link Here
343
343
344
        if( visual_bin_set_video( bin, video ) ) exit( "Cannot set video" );
344
        if( visual_bin_set_video( bin, video ) ) exit( "Cannot set video" );
345
345
346
        visual_bin_connect_by_names( bin, (char*)plugin, 0 );
346
        visual_bin_connect_by_names( bin, (char*)plugin, NULL );
347
347
348
        if( visual_bin_get_depth( bin ) == VISUAL_VIDEO_DEPTH_GL )
348
        if( visual_bin_get_depth( bin ) == VISUAL_VIDEO_DEPTH_GL )
349
        {
349
        {
(-)amarok-1.4.1/amarok/src/vis/libvisual/libvisual.h~ (-3 / +3 lines)
Lines 20-26 extern "C" Link Here
20
20
21
namespace SDL
21
namespace SDL
22
{
22
{
23
    static SDL_Surface *screen = 0;
23
    static SDL_Surface *screen = NULL;
24
    static SDL_Color    pal[256];
24
    static SDL_Color    pal[256];
25
25
26
    static void init();
26
    static void init();
Lines 62-68 namespace LibVisual Link Here
62
    {
62
    {
63
        plugin = visual_actor_get_next_by_name( plugin );
63
        plugin = visual_actor_get_next_by_name( plugin );
64
64
65
        if( plugin == 0 ) plugin = visual_actor_get_next_by_name( 0 );
65
        if( plugin == NULL ) plugin = visual_actor_get_next_by_name( NULL );
66
    }
66
    }
67
67
68
    static inline void
68
    static inline void
Lines 70-76 namespace LibVisual Link Here
70
    {
70
    {
71
        plugin = visual_actor_get_prev_by_name( plugin );
71
        plugin = visual_actor_get_prev_by_name( plugin );
72
72
73
        if( plugin == 0 ) plugin = visual_actor_get_prev_by_name( 0 );
73
        if( plugin == NULL ) plugin = visual_actor_get_prev_by_name( NULL );
74
    }
74
    }
75
75
76
    static inline void
76
    static inline void

Return to bug 9869